Hi there, I'm Donna! Donna Young is a Licensed Professional Counselor in the State of Georgia with over 20 years of experience assisting adolescents, teens, young adults, and families with managing anxiety, depression, relationship issues, and adjusting to life. She earned her Master's in Mental Health Counseling from Capella University. My approach Donna takes an eclectic approach that meets the client where they are and encompasses cognitive-behavioral, solution-focused, and person-centered therapy. My focus Donna has worked with clients ages 7 to 68, with diagnoses including adjustment disorder, Major Depressive Disorder, Anxiety Disorder, Anti-Social Personality Disorder, and disorders on the Autism Spectrum. She treats clients on the Telehealth platform as well as in a private office. My communication style Donna creates an environment built on trust, understanding, flexibility, and safety. Clients who work with Donna will feel empowered through a series of coping skills that allow them to express their needs and wants while respecting the needs and wants of others. My journey to mental healthcare I worked in the customer service field for years and I love children. A friend noticed my passion for the work I was doing and directed me to a foster care agency to put my skills to use helping others. My passion for people and their success is what drives me to continue in this field. My goals for you Goal setting is a major step in treatment that must be developed with the client. This has to be what the client wants to achieve in treatment. My first session with you Clients should expect to learn about the development of the counseling relationship and have the opportunity to ask questions about who I am as a therapist.
